   44-2-9.    Recording leases, usufructs, and assignments thereof; effect as notice 
      When  executed with the formality prescribed for the execution of deeds to  land, leases or usufructs of land or of any interest in land and  assignments of such leases or usufructs for any purpose, including the  purpose of securing debt, may be recorded in the county where the  property described in the instrument is located. The record shall, from  the date of filing, be notice of the interest of the parties to the  lease or usufructs in the property described in the instrument and of  the interest of any person holding an assignment of any interest in such  lease or usufruct.
